Measuring Cybersecurity Business Value
Quantifying cybersecurity impact requires clear metrics that link controls to business outcomes. A concise summary table below highlights how to assess digital risk in financial and operational terms.
| Metric | Definition | Unit | Target |
|---|---|---|---|
| Annual Loss Expectancy (ALE) | Expected financial loss from incidents per year | USD | Decrease YOY |
| Return on Security Investment (ROSI) | Benefit compared to security spend | Percentage | Positive and above industry benchmark |
| Mean Time to Detect (MTTD) | Average time to identify a breach | Hours | Under 4 hours for critical systems |
| Patch SLA Compliance | Percentage of systems patched within policy | Percentage | Above 95% |
| Third-Party Risk Score | Aggregated risk rating for external vendors | Index 1–10 | Below 3 |

Risk Quantification and Reporting
Adopting standard risk quantification methods allows security teams to express cybersecurity net worth summary in financial terms that executives understand. FAIR-based models complement control coverage data with probable loss estimates.
Consistent reporting cadence ties findings to trends, showing how investments change the organization’s risk trajectory over time.

How do I calculate ROSI for a new security project?
Divide the expected risk reduction in USD by the total project cost, including implementation, training, and ongoing operations.
What does a high MTTD indicate about detection capabilities?
A high MTTD suggests that monitoring, alerting, or response processes need improvement to identify incidents faster.
